UNDERDOGS Tempest United could not spring an upset in the Hospital Cup final as holders Ramsbottom United ran out 5-1 winners to lift the trophy for a second successive season.

The village side, based in Chew Moor, Lostock, had no answer to the semi-professional North West Counties League Division One outfit at Bolton Wanderers' Reebok Stadium on Friday night.

It was Tempest's third appearance in the final of the competition - but there was to be no hat-trick of successes for the West Lancashire League amateurs as they were steamrolled by Ramsbottom.

Tempest were looking to repeat their giant-killing heroics of 1998 and 2000, but the Rams prolific striker, Ryan Moore, proved the difference between the two sides as he grabbed a personal treble, though Steve Ford's team battled bravely to the end despite being reduced to 10 men after having a player sent off late on.
